Asiwaju Bola Tinubu: The strategist as game changer
The significance of it was not lost on many when last month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u moved the annual colloquium hosted on his birthday from Lagos to Abuja, the federal capital. The annual colloquium had in recent past been a forum for the political class to ponder Nigeria’s socio-political milieu, and of course, an opportunity to celebrate the man generally applauded as the Pathfinder.
